The Energy Bus - Focusing and Finding a Vision for School 1/12/2011
Today I referred to the energy bus in my morning message. I asked students to think about their future, their classroom. Rule #2: Desire, Vision, and Focus Move Your Bus in the Right Direction. Some of my students don’t have a focus or goal. I think that’s why they “float” through the day in a noncommittal way, constantly crossing the rules line. They completed a visions sheet for their behavior, academic success, friendships and classroom. I'm not sure just writing it down will change anything for them, but I think I am gaining understanding into some of my student behavior problems.
